How to survive the flight to Espalais?
Wherever you’re jetting in from, flying can be a pleasant experience if you’ve prepared well enough. We’ve compiled a list of handy travel tips that will get your Espalais escape started on the right note.What to pack in your hand luggage:

  • Firstly, and most importantly, pack in your passport, travel documents, cash and daily medications. Next, you’ll want some entertainment to while away the time. A thrilling novel and a phone crammed with your favorite shows are always good options. If you intend to take a quick nap, a neck pillow and some noise-canceling headphones will also be useful. Finally, leave some space for a toothbrush and some deodorant so you’ll step off the plane looking fresh and raring to go.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• While the list of banned items differs between airlines, the general guide to follow is avoid carrying anything flammable, sharp or explosive. This includes tools, metal cutlery, fuels and bleaching agents. Sporting equipment like bows and arrows, and items that could harm passengers, such as firearms and ammunition, can’t come on board with you either.

What to wear on a flight:

  • Comfort should be your main priority when selecting what to wear on board. Consider your choice of footwear with care too, as swollen feet can be a side effect of flying. Shoes which are flat and slightly roomy work well.
  • Unfortunately, a risk of flying long distances is developing DVT (deep vein thrombosis), a blood clot condition caused by lengthy periods of inactivity. To avoid this, take every opportunity to walk around and give your legs a stretch. Compression tights and socks are also a great idea to help lower your risk.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Espalais?
It’s all about being prepared. We’ve put together some handy tips and tricks for an easy trip through security. Watch out Espalais, here you come:

  • First things first. Your travel ID and boarding pass will need to be inspected by security personnel. Keep them someplace accessible so you don’t hold up the queue.
  • Time to strip down. Well sort of. Your belt, coat, keys and other items in your pocket, like your earphones, will be required to go through the X-ray machine. Make the whole process faster by removing them as your turn draws near.
  • Your electronic gadgets like laptops and phones will also need to go on a tray for inspection. Don’t worry though, you’ll be back online in no time.
  • Remember to remove gels and liquids from your carry-on luggage. They usually need to be sent through the X-ray machine separately. Each item should be in a container no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) and everything must fit inside a quart-size (one liter), clear zip-lock bag.
  • Lightweight sneakers are a practical footwear choice as you’re less likely to be asked to remove them when passing through security. Hiking boots and other heavy-style shoes are often subjected to additional screening.
  • Avoid taking prohibited items in your carry-on bag. If you have any sharp or pointed objects, pack them in your checked baggage. They won’t be allowed in the cabin.
